ZABIDA Visits Bicol

TO improve the planning and implementation of their respective community development and peace-building projects, officers of the Bicol Consortium for Development Initiatives, In. (BCDI) and Zamboanga-Basilan Integrated Development Alliance (ZABIDA) have been conducting twice-yearly exchange field visits since last year.

ZABIDA officers undertook a reciprocal visitation to Bicol last August 18-22 to assess the status of their two organizations’ projects, which include basic health and related services to poor communities, promotion of good governance, environmental preservation, micro-lending and economic capacity-building, and peace.

Both groups’ programs are funded by the Spanish government, being implemented from 2007-2010 under the supervision of the international Manos Unidas foundation.
